STEP 01 · WEEK 1
Every project starts with the right questions. We learn your goals, project type, key spaces, budget direction, timeline, and decision process so our team can recommend the right products, samples, and support from the beginning.
STEP 02 Weeks 1–3
We help translate your brief into product layouts, finish directions, and visual references for spaces such as workstations, meeting rooms, reception areas, lounges, and executive offices. Renderings and light planning help your team understand how the products will work together before an order is placed.
STEP 03 WEEK 3
Eureka helps source and specify products across furniture, lighting, flooring, partitions, décor, storage, and specialty categories. Your team receives product options, imagery, specifications, warranty information, sample support, and estimated timelines so decisions stay clear before purchasing.
STEP 04 WEEK 4+
Once products are approved, Eureka supports order tracking, delivery coordination, documentation, and after-sales follow-up. White-glove service, assembly, or installation-related support may be available depending on product category, project location, and approved scope.
*Full on-site installation is available in select California markets. Outside California, delivery, white-glove, assembly, or installation-related support may vary by category, location, and partner availability.
